About
The Team: Our team is responsible for the design, architecture, and development of client-facing applications using MI Platform and Office Add-Ins that are regularly updated as new technologies emerge. You will have the opportunity to work with people from a wide variety of backgrounds and develop close team dynamics with coworkers from around the globe, fostering a collaborative environment that values technical excellence.
Responsibilities and Impact
Design, architect, and develop client-facing applications using MI Platform and Office Add-Ins, directly impacting daily decision-making in global capital and commodities markets
Provide technical leadership and mentoring to development teams, championing best practices and serving as a subject matter expert in .NET technologies
Engineer scalable components and common services using standard development models, producing high-quality code that powers enterprise-level financial products
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to analyze complex problems, isolate issues, and develop solutions that support key business objectives
Lead technical walkthroughs and produce comprehensive system design documents to guide development initiatives
Continuously improve application architecture and development processes, ensuring adoption of emerging technologies and industry best practices
What We're Looking For Basic Required Qualifications
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or equivalent experience with 5+ years of application development using Microsoft Technologies
Strong expertise in object-oriented design, .NET Framework, and software design patterns with proficiency in C# development
Experience with modern web technologies, including JavaScript frameworks (such as React.js, Angular, or Vue.js), TypeScript, and micro frontend architectures
Hands‑on experience with Microsoft development stack, including ADO.NET, ASP.NET, and web service technologies (such as WCF, Web API, or REST services)
Proficiency with relational database technologies on SQL Server platform, including stored procedure development using T‑SQL
Experience with software development lifecycle methodologies such as Agile, SAFe, or test‑driven development practices
Additional Preferred Qualifications
Experience developing Office 365 add‑ins, Office plugins, or Microsoft Office integration solutions
Knowledge of cloud platforms such as Azure, AWS, or Google Cloud with experience in containerization technologies (such as Docker, Kubernetes, or OpenShift)
Excellent communication and collaboration skills with ability to work effectively across global teams and present technical concepts to non‑technical stakeholders
Compensation/Benefits Information S&P Global states that the anticipated base salary range for this position is $105,000 to $125,000. Final base salary for this role will be based on the individual’s geographic location, as well as experience level, skill set, training, licenses and certifications.
In addition to base compensation, this role is eligible for an annual incentive plan. This role is not eligible for additional compensation such as an annual incentive bonus or sales commission plan.
This role is eligible to receive additional S&P Global benefits. For more information on the benefits we provide to our employees, please click here (https://spgbenefits.com/benefit-summaries/us).
This role requires being on-site at a designated office 2‑3 days/week.
